Skip to content

Conversation

angerman
Copy link

@angerman angerman commented Sep 8, 2025

Under some rare circumstances (e.g. custom GHC API code building custom ghc-internal package), GHC may try to load GHC.Internal.Prim without building it first. Allow this for backward compatibility.

Upstream MR: !14777

Under some rare circumstances (e.g. custom GHC API code building custom
ghc-internal package), GHC may try to load GHC.Internal.Prim without
building it first. Allow this for backward compatibility.
@angerman angerman marked this pull request as draft September 8, 2025 02:38
@angerman angerman added the upstreaming This PR is in the process of being upstreamed label Sep 8, 2025
@angerman angerman mentioned this pull request Sep 8, 2025
@angerman
Copy link
Author

angerman commented Sep 9, 2025

This was closed upstream. The necessary fixes (for us) are in https://gitlab.haskell.org/ghc/ghc/-/merge_requests/14685. Which is in master, and 9.14, and not necessary for 9.12

@angerman angerman closed this Sep 9, 2025
@angerman angerman deleted the hsyl20/25686-fix-prim-module branch September 9, 2025 08:38
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

upstreaming This PR is in the process of being upstreamed

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ants